NIDHI GUPTA, J.
CM-1039-CII-2025 This is an application under Section 5 of Limitation Act for condonation of delay of 336 days in filing the appeal.
After going through the contents of the application, which is supported by affidavit of the appellant No.1, the same is allowed subject to all just exceptions and delay of 336 days in filing present appeal is condoned.
MAIN CASE Present appeal has been filed by the claimants seeking enhancement of compensation of Rs.40,00,926/- awarded by the Motor Accident Claims Tribunal, Ludhiana (hereinafter ‘the learned Tribunal’) vide Award dated 17.08.2023 passed in MACP Case No.110 of 2022 filed under Section 166 of the Motor Vehicles Act (hereinafter “the Act”).
